Computer Basics is for the very beginner to introduce fundamental concepts and skills related to using computers. The class encompasses keyboarding, mouse skills, internet and email basics among other basic applications.
A series of 4 classes offered through Creative Aging of the Mid-South. Classes are filled.

GRIND CITY MEET- Beginning series of workshops on photography.
GRIND CITY MEET- A 4 week photography series exploring the essentials and fundamentals of photography from camera basics to photo editing.
Registration recommended but not required.
